Frequently Asked Questions

Inglewood's cost of living index is 115.5 vs Las Vegas's 101.6 (US average = 100). Las Vegas is 14% less expensive overall.

Inglewood, CA and Las Vegas, NV are about 235 miles apart (straight-line distance). Driving distance will be longer depending on the route.
